Maya's Hope is a 501(c)3 organization that is dedicated to improving the lives of orphaned, special needs, and disadvantaged children on a global scale.
Maya's Hope is seeking a passionate HR specialist to join our team and help us recruit, onboard, train, and retain talented volunteers.
As an HR specialist, you will play a crucial role in supporting Maya's Hope's mission by ensuring we have a strong and committed volunteer base.
- Recruiting Volunteers: You will collaborate with the HR team to develop effective recruitment strategies and create engaging job descriptions and volunteer postings. You will utilize various channels, including social media, online platforms, and networking events, to attract prospective volunteers who align with our organization's values and goals.
- Onboarding and Orientation: You will facilitate the onboarding process, ensuring they have a smooth transition into their roles. You will coordinate orientation sessions, provide the necessary paperwork, and offer guidance on organizational policies, procedures, and expectations.
- Training and Development: You will collaborate with the program managers to identify the training needs of volunteers and develop training activities. This may involve creating training materials, organizing and facilitating team meetings, and providing ongoing support and guidance to volunteers to enhance their skills and knowledge.
- Retention and Engagement: You will develop and implement initiatives to foster volunteer engagement and satisfaction. This may include organizing recognition events, implementing feedback mechanisms, and establishing regular communication channels to ensure volunteers feel valued, supported, and connected to the organization's mission.
- HR Support: You will assist the team with various administrative tasks, such as maintaining volunteer records, updating databases, and ensuring compliance with applicable laws and regulations related to volunteering.

Time Commitment:
This volunteer position requires a commitment of approximately 10-15 hours per week. The schedule can be flexible based on the availability of the volunteer.

Mission Statement
Maya’s Hope works to improve the quality of life of orphaned, impoverished, and special-needs children on a global scale. Whether providing funding for loving caregivers, vitamin-rich formula, or access to quality medical care, Maya’s Hope improves lives, one child at a time!
